Schema medical speciality error
-
I'm having an issue correctly formatting a medical specialty for a gastroenterologist. The Google structured data tool is giving me the error of "The property specialty is not recognized by Google for an object of type _Physician". _
Any suggestions on how to correctly update the schema code for a physician's specialty?
Thanks,
Keith
-
Hi Martijn. You're right that we should use MedicalSpecialty, but we are still getting an error in the Google structured data tool after making this change. We'll get it figured out, I have just been busy with other projects and will look at the issue again later. Thanks!
-
@Keith, were you able to figure out the solution to this problem?
-
Keith, it seems that speciality is not a valid property. The documentation doesn't mention it at all, so I would look into using MedicalSpecialty which you can find more information right here: http://health-lifesci.schema.org/medicalSpecialty
-
I realized the image with the schema code is difficult to read. Here are the 2 lines, which are relevant to the question...
http://schema.org/Physician">http://schema.org/ Gastroenterologic" />
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Unsolved Duplicate LocalBusiness Schema Markup
Hello! I've been having a hard time finding an answer to this specific question so I figured I'd drop it here. I always add custom LocalBusiness markup to clients' homepages, but sometimes the client's website provider will include their own automated LocalBusiness markup. The codes I create often include more information. Assuming the website provider is unwilling to remove their markup, is it a bad idea to include my code as well? It seems like it could potentially be read as spammy by Google. Do the pros of having more detailed markup outweigh that potential negative impact?
Local Website Optimization | | GoogleAlgoServant0 -
Knowledge Graph Details can be changed through Knowledge Graph Schema
Hello, all! I have a client who's Fortune 500 - has all the good "stuff" that is associated with pulling in proper info into the knowledge graph/company information box - Wikipedia, strong citations, etc., but the CEO name is showing the old CEO name althopugh we haven't mentioned it in wiki neither on our website but still google is picking it from somewhere else & showing the previous CEO name. How can i change it? Thanks!
Local Website Optimization | | dhananjay.kumar10 -
Local Business Schema Image requirement
Hello, I work exclusively with Dentists and we have been putting our json schema in the footer for a while now. Just recently they made 'image' a requirement for the Dentist category. We already use the logo in our schema and that is an image. Since the schema is in the footer, it is on every page, and the only image on every page is the logo. Does the image we add to our schema need to be on the actual web page or could it be anything related to the business, like an image of the practice or the dentist? Would it hurt to have the logo listed twice in the schema - once as the logo and once as the image? Trying to figure out what the best thing to do is for the required 'image' field for a dentist. Thanks! Angela
Local Website Optimization | | tntdental0 -
What is the SEO effect of schema subtype deprecation? Do I really have to update the subtype if there isn't a suitable alternative?
Could someone please elaborate on the SEO effect of schema subtype deprecation? Does it even matter? The Local business properties section of developers.google.com says to: Define each local business location as a LocalBusiness type. Use the most specific LocalBusiness sub-type possible; for example, Restaurant, DaySpa, HealthClub, and so on. Unfortunately, the ProfessionalService page of schema.org states that ProfessionalService has been deprecated and many of my clients don't fit anywhere else (or if they do it's not a LocalBusiness subtype). I find it inconvenient to have to modify my different clients' JSON-LD from LocalBusiness to ProfessionalService back to LocalBusiness. I'm not saying this happens every day but how does one keep up with it all? I'm really trying to take advantage of the numerous types, attributes, etc., in structured data but I feel the more I implement, the harder it will be to update later (true of many things, of course). I do feel this is important and that a better workflow could be the answer. If you have something that works for you, please let us know. If you think it's not important tell us why not? (Why Google is wrong) I understand there is always a better use of our time, but I'd like to limit the discussion to solving this Google/Schema.org deprecation issue specifically.
Local Website Optimization | | bulletproofsearch0 -
404 error from linking page that does not exist
We migrated our site from php to wordpress about a month ago. All of the old website files have been removed. I ran Moz analytics and get 17 critical 404 errors from linking pages that do not exist. 404 : Received 404 (Not Found) error response for page. http://www.preventivesupport.com/freeestimates.php404010http://preventivesupport.com/freeestimates.phpN/AThe www thing is interesting but freeestimates.php does not exist?
Local Website Optimization | | KrisIrr0 -
Will NAP Schema Impact non local searches
Hi, Just got a business address and a toll free number for my website. I have read that adding the NAP details schema to the site gives that additional weight of trust to Google and also helps local search. Now my website is NOT local. However, if I add my LA address details on my website using the Local Business schema.org, it might give Google the impression that I am based out of CA. Fair enough, but my question is, will it impact negatively for SERPs from other states. For example I might want to rank for KW "Autism Alternative Treatment". Obviously now that I have added my NAP, if someone keys in Autism Alternative Treatment LA or Autism Alternative Treatment CA, google should give my site preference. But if someone searched Autism Alternative Treatment Arizona, will google exclude/downgrade me (even though there may not be a local site for Arizona) from the search results under the pretext that I am not Arizona based? Your suggestion would be very helpful.
Local Website Optimization | | DealWithAutism0 -
Schema - Street Address
I'm starting to use schema on a site currently working on the business address in the footer. What is the correct way to use data that has more than one line? So for example the address is something like "Unit 1, Some Farm, Some Street..." Unit 1, Some Farm Some Street or Unit 1, Some Farm
Local Website Optimization | | MickEdwards
Some Street0 -
Local Business Schema Markup on every page?
Hello, I have two questions..if someone could shed some light on the topic, I would be so very grateful! 1. I am still making my way through how schema is employed, and as I can tell, it is much more specific (and therefore relevant) in its details than using the data highlighter tool. Is this true? 2. Most of my clients' sites have a footer with the local business info included on every page of their site (address and phone). This said, I have been using the structured data markup helper to add local business schema to home page, and then including the footer markup in the footer file so that every page benefits from the local business markup. Is this incorrect to use it for every page? Also, I noticed that by just using the footer markup for the rest of the pages in the site, I am missing data that was included when I manually went through the index page (i.e. image, url, name of business). Could someone tell me if it is advisable and worth it to manually markup every page for the local business schema or if that should just be used for certain pages such as location, contact us, and/or index? Any tips or help would be greatly appreciated!!! Thanks
Local Website Optimization | | lfrazer0